Florence May Patton
The Washington Times-Herald
        Wed.,  4 Aug 1965 
Patton Funeral To Be Saturday
        Mrs. Florence May Patton, 46 years old, 611 Morton St., died at the Daviess
          County Hospital at 10:20 a.m. today after a serious illness of ten
          months.
        Mrs. Patton was born January 15, 1919 in Washington township, the daughter
        of Charles and Anna (Gardner) Faith, and was educated in the local schools.
        She was married April 24, 1938 to Robert Patton. Mrs. Patton was employed
        in the finishing department of the U.S. Rubber Company ans was a member
        of the Veale Creek Baptist church and the Women of the Moose.
        Besides her parents, she leaves three children: Mrs. LeRoy (Carolyn Sue)
        Weirich, Lawrenceville, Illinois; Mrs. Paul (Janet Elaine) Waggoner,
        East Chicago, Illinois and Mrs. Bruce (Patricia Ann) Harper, Loogootee;
        seven grandchildren and five brothers and three sisters: Elmer Faith,
        Phoenix, Arizona; Robert Faith, Glendale, Arizona and Albert Faith, Charles
        Faith Jr., Alvin Faith, Mrs. Malcolm (Onie) Ritterskamp, Mrs. Harlan
        (Hazel) Chesnut, and Mrs. Bernard M. (Bonnie) Crow, all of this city.
        The funeral will be at 2 p.m. Saturday in the Gill Chapel where friends
        may call after 7 p.m. Thursday. Burial will be in the Plainville cemetery.
